Permit Requirements in Elmendorf
Know when you need a permit to ensure your project is legal and safe
General Rules
Electrical permits are often required in Elmendorf for repairs impacting safety, capacity, or the main system.
Minor jobs like swapping a light bulb or outlet (like-for-like) may skip permits, but confirm first.
Work without permits risks fines, failed inspections, or insurance issues.
When Permits Are Required
Permits typically needed for:
- Rewiring or adding circuits
- Panel upgrades or replacements
- Service entrance modifications
- Load-increasing repairs
- Any structural electrical changes
Check locally as rules follow Texas and NEC guidelines.
Common Exemptions
Common exemptions:
- Like-for-like replacements
- Low-voltage systems (<50V)
- Portable device repairs
- Ceiling fan swaps (same mount)
Even exempt work should follow codes – hire pros.

Permit Process
Step 1: Confirm Need
Contact Elmendorf or Bexar County building department to verify permit requirements for your repair. Gather basic project details.
Step 2: Submit Application
Prepare plans, specs, and licensed electrician info. File online or in-person, pay fees (vary by scope).
Step 3: Review & Approval
Department reviews for code compliance. Address any revisions promptly.
Step 4: Work & Inspections
Start after approval. Call for rough-in and final inspections to pass.
